Breakthrough Advancements in Real-time Payment Processing Optimization (Published)
This article examines the transformative advancements in real-time payment processing optimization and their profound impact on digital commerce. It explores how millisecond-level processing improvements significantly enhance conversion rates in high-volume e-commerce environments. Key innovations discussed include intelligent predictive routing algorithms that leverage historical data to make real-time transaction routing decisions, the implementation of standardized interfaces like Payment Request API and ISO 20022, and privacy-preserving optimization techniques compliant with evolving regulatory frameworks. It further analyzes the substantial impact of these optimizations on e-commerce conversion rates, demonstrating how they reduce cart abandonment and improve customer trust and retention. Looking ahead, the article considers emerging technologies such as Central Bank Digital Currencies and distributed ledger systems that promise to further revolutionize payment processing with faster settlement times, lower costs, and expanded financial inclusion. The article findings suggest that payment processing optimization has evolved beyond technical consideration to become a strategic business imperative with measurable revenue impact and broader economic implications.
